Transaction 511fc25bc60f47439f45c15b924dfad76b8e1dfb203d33eeec033e71d5fccb9c

1 Input
2 Outputs
  • 511fc25bc60f47439f45c15b924dfad76b8e1dfb203d33eeec033e71d5fccb9c:0
  • value  1574359075
    address  3HemupHqq87JWkhNhVd1FP76UFhpDcQxh5
  • 511fc25bc60f47439f45c15b924dfad76b8e1dfb203d33eeec033e71d5fccb9c:1
  • value  2146453221
    address  bc1q0qfzuge7vr5s2xkczrjkccmxemlyyn8mhx298v